Before Day26, before Mindless Behavior, there was an R&B Boy Band straight outta Chicago with all the promise in the WORLD. Originally a five piece and then four, One Chance was discovered by Usher and signed by Clive Davis on the spot. Their debut single “Look At Her” featuring Fabo of D4L had MySpace and 106 & Park in a chokehold. Their debut album ‘Private’ continued to get pushed back and eventually shelved due to continuing changes at J Records [several acts saw this fate during the J/Jive/Zomba/RCA shakeup]. After leaving J/US, they signed with T-Pain over at Nappy Boy which brought their mixtape ‘Ain’t No Room For Talkin’’. One Chance never really got their “chance” and that sucks because they truly deserved it. “Could This Be Love” is one of my favorite leaks from them. The story of I-15 is just sad. Signed to Polow Da Don via Zone 4/Interscope, I-15 had a A LOT of promise. We had a Black boy band that was rapping, singing, dancing, and had a sound that stood out from anything on radio. They were often called a “male TLC”. “Lost In Love” received heavy play on several music stations in 2007 from MTV Hits, 106 & Park, MTV Jams, and VH1 Soul. After “Lost In Love” and featuring on “Soulja Girl”, they vanished. From what I know, the album was completed and came out fire, but was shelved. JR Castro ended up dropping his debut album 10 years later called ‘Sexpectations Vol. 1’ and allegedly, the members were still under contract with Polow [like Keri Hilson for example until recently]. Shout out to Castro, Das, & Flash for making one unforgettable record. “Lost In Love” is still in constant rotation over here. I-15 deserved more. #TBT
